On 1 June 2004 www.winenews.co.za brought you news about an exciting new project for children with Foetal Alcohol Syndrome in the winelands called 'pebbles'.

The aim is to provide a centre for these children and their families where they can receive specialist educational support, adult education and skills training and health advice.

Mentioned in the article was the desperate need for a suitable building in the Stellenbosch area that can be used to create this invaluable resource. The project is looking for a 3 or 4 roomed building with toilet facilities ideally, but any building or even plot of land will be considered.

There are children with special needs already identified in the wine growing region, who are waiting to come and make maximum use of the facilities at the centre – what they need now is a building.
